ISO 10523 pH Measurement in WastewaterISO 10523 pH Measurement in Wastewater Testing: A Comprehensive Guide
ISO 10523 is a widely recognized standard for pH measurement in wastewater testing, published by the International Organization for Standardization (ISO). This standard provides guidelines and requirements for laboratories to ensure accurate and reliable pH measurements.
The ISO 10523 standard is based on the principles of the pH scale, which measures the concentration of hydrogen ions in a solution. The pH value is a critical parameter in wastewater testing, as it affects the treatment process, water quality, and environmental impact.
Legal and Regulatory Framework
The legal and regulatory framework surrounding ISO 10523 pH measurement in wastewater testing is governed by various national and international standards. In Europe, for example, the standard is implemented through the European Committee for Standardization (CEN) and the European Unions Water Framework Directive (2000/60/EC).
In the United States, the Environmental Protection Agency (EPA) regulates pH measurements in wastewater testing through the Clean Water Act (33 U.S.C. 1251 et seq.). Similarly, in Australia, the National Water Quality Management Strategy (NWQMS) sets guidelines for pH measurement in wastewater testing.
